A bit about the job:

The API & Integration Architect designs and evolves Aviva’s API‑led and event‑driven integration landscape, helping ensure systems connect in a secure, scalable, and well‑governed way. The role shapes enterprise integration patterns across cloud, on‑prem, and multi‑market platforms, supporting Aviva’s digital, operational, and data ambitions. Working closely with engineering, security, and architecture teams, you’ll help move the organisation towards more decoupled, resilient, and reusable integration solutions.

Skills and experience we’re looking for: 

  • API Architecture & Design (Synchronous and Asynchronous) - Ability to design scalable, secure, standards‑aligned APIs—including synchronous request/response and asynchronous/event‑driven patterns—to support modern integration across a complex system landscape. 
  • Event‑Driven Integration & Event Backbone Architecture - Expertise in architecting event streaming patterns, decoupled services, and backbone evolution to reduce system fragility and enable real‑time, domain‑driven data flows. 
  • Integration Platform & Middleware Engineering - Strong understanding of integration middleware (e.g., API gateways like Kong, event brokers, ETL/ELT, file transfer, RPA integration methods), enabling secure and performant cross‑platform connectivity. 
  • Cloud‑Native & Container‑Based Deployment Patterns - Knowledge of container orchestration, cloud hosting, zero‑trust controls, and scalable deployment models that underpin resilient integration capabilities. 
  • API Governance, Security & Discoverability - Skill in defining standards for API security, metadata, cataloguing, observability, versioning, lifecycle governance, and aligning integration practices with enterprise frameworks and CISO policies
